Default cheap AND dependable heads

Can you really buy a good dependable set of heads for around $1000 that will make good hp? (30+)
It's a common question, but I am looking for some heads for my wife's cammed/bolt on C5, and don't think (from endless reading) that the unmodified 243s are worth it, and not willing to spend $1800-$2000 for a set of heads for what she uses the car for.

I went through the same crap when I was deciding which heads to get. It's one of those cases where it all depends on how much Hp you plan on putting on the car. Preditor gave me some great advice, he said if you don't want over 500RWHP then just save the money and PP your 243's! I wanted around 450 RWHP so I sent my 243's off to get worked up by a company who did a great job. It wasn't cheap but for what I wanted $1000 bucks was well spent with them!

PRC 243 or 5.3L heads will give you more than the HP you are looking for and cost around $1000-1100. They seem to have more R&D than the patriot heads.

I also don't think that the work to swap in stock 243s is worth it either. Usually only shows about 20-25rwhp

Tim the TSP/PRC 5.3L heads are worth 30-35rwhp all day for just a hair over $1K. I've installed a few sets this year and I must say I've been thoroughly impressed with the quality of their new stuff. They're running a $100 off special right now I believe where you can get the Stg 2.5's for around $1200 with their dual springs. Prob could save some more money and drop down to the PAC 1218 springs with that EPS cam and get it close to $1100.
